SUMMARY
A 1930's semi-detached house comprising entrance hallway, lounge, dining room, kitchen, downstairs cloakroom, three bedrooms, a shower room and a loft room. Benefiting from gas central heating and PVCu double glazing, front and rear gardens, a detached garage and parking for several cars.
